You will have to manually configure it. You might want to read up on
disabling GRUU with it also. It has its own web interface to manually
configure it. In general, SNOM has known interoperability issues, and the
mfr doesn't put a lot of emphasis on fixing them, hence the lack of
management plugins. That plus the abundance of phones without interop issues
pushes things towards those models.

Subject: [sipx-users] Snom 870

I am a newbie to sipXecs and everything VOIP. I'd appreciate any help I can
get.

I just installed the 4.0.4 ISO. But, sipXecs can't discover the spanking new
Snom 870s that I have on the network. Reading some posts from back in May
2008, I gather these phones may not be supported yet. Is there any way I can
make these phones register and work with sipXecs, with some manual effort?
